Tips for Identifying Unlicensed Brokers:
To avoid falling prey to investment scams, it’s essential to be aware of the following indicators:
- Unlicensed or unregistered brokers often lack clear and concise information about their regulatory status.
- Be cautious of brokers making exaggerated claims or promises of unusually high returns.
- Legitimate brokers will always provide transparent and responsive customer support.
- Research the broker’s reputation online, looking for reviews and feedback from other users.
Steps to Take After Falling for a Scam:
If you’ve already fallen victim to Bittradeex.com or a similar unlicensed broker, take the following steps to protect yourself:
- Stop all communication: Cease all interactions with the scammer, including responding to emails or messages.
- Report the scam: Inform relevant authorities, such as the Federal Trade Commission (FTC) or your local financial regulatory body, about the scam.
- Contact your bank or payment provider: Notify your bank or payment provider about the unauthorized transactions and request their assistance in recovering any lost funds.
- Consider identity theft protection: Monitor your credit reports and consider enlisting the services of an identity theft protection agency to safeguard your personal and financial information.
- Warn others: Share your experience through reviews and scam reporting websites to help prevent others from falling victim to the same scam.
